Clovis - c. 482 - 511 CE - Clovis was the leader of a Frankish tribe who eventually unified and ruled all Franks. Clovis converted from paganism to become a Catholic Christian around 500 CE. This conversion helped him gain papal support, as well as leading to the eventual conversion of most of the Frankish peoples. Clovis also established the Merovigian dynasty. person
